Installation and Replacement Procedures

Replacing the water inlet valve of your Whirlpool washing machine is a relatively straightforward process that requires some basic tools and knowledge of plumbing. Before starting, it’s essential to understand the necessary steps involved to ensure a smooth replacement process.

Necessary Tools and Precautions

To replace the water inlet valve safely and effectively, you will need the following tools:
– A wrench or socket set for loosening and tightening connections.
– A Phillips screwdriver for removing screws that hold the valve cover in place.
– A vacuum cleaner to clean out any debris or water that may be present after removing the old valve.
Before starting the replacement process, make sure to:
– Disconnect the power cord from the washing machine to prevent any accidental start-ups.
– Turn off the water supply to the washing machine by locating the shut-off valves and turning them clockwise.

Steps Involved in Replacing the Water Inlet Valve

1.

  • Disconnect the water supply lines from the old valve. Use a wrench or adjustable wrench to loosen the nuts holding the supply lines in place. Once loose, carefully lift the supply lines off the old valve.
  • Disconnect the electrical connections from the old valve. Use a Phillips screwdriver to remove the screws holding the valve cover in place.
  • Remove the old valve from the washing machine. This may require some force, so be careful not to damage any surrounding components.
  • Install the new valve in the same location as the old one. Make sure it’s securely fastened and properly connected to the water supply lines and electrical connections.
  • Reconnect the water supply lines to the new valve, tightening the nuts securely.
  • Reconnect the electrical connections to the new valve, ensuring a snug and secure fit.
  • Turn on the water supply to the washing machine and check for any leaks at the connections.
  • Test the new valve by running a washing cycle and checking for proper water flow and temperature regulation.

FAQ

What are the common signs of a faulty whirlpool washing machine water inlet valve?

Leaking or excessive water usage, faulty or stuck valve, and failure to shut off the water supply are common signs of a faulty whirlpool washing machine water inlet valve.

Can I replace the whirlpool washing machine water inlet valve myself or should I hire a professional?

Replacig the whirlpool washing machine water inlet valve yourself is posible, but if you are not comfortable with DIY repairs, it’s recommended to hire a professional.

What are the precautions I should take when working with the whirlpool washing machine water inlet valve?

Always turn off the water supply and unplug the washing machine before starting any repairs. Wear protective gloves and eyewear, and ensure a well-ventilated working area.
